The beauty of flowers is well known, inspiring creative minds from Botticelli to Beatrix Potter. But they've also played a key part in forming the past, and may shape our future. Roses and thistles have served as symbols of monarchs, dynasties and nations. We wear poppies to remember the First World War, but it was the elderflower that treated its wounded soldiers. A rose might mend a broken heart, and sunflowers may just save our planet. At once enchanting and intriguing, The Brief Life of Flowers reveals how even the most ordinary of flowers have extraordinary stories to tell.

Fiona Stafford

Fiona Stafford is a renowned British author and academic known for her work "The Long, Long Life of Trees." Her writing style blends scholarly research with poetic prose, exploring the cultural and environmental significance of trees in literature. Stafford's contributions to literature offer a fresh perspective on the natural world.
